Description
Bug
FCOS/RHCOS VM fails to boot on Nutanix without an Ignition config. So the VM execution doesn't go past the fetch-offline stage
Operating System Version
FCOS: 36.20220505.3.2
Ignition Version
v2.14.0
Environment
What hardware/cloud provider/hypervisor is being used to run Ignition?
Nutanix AHV
Expected Behavior
FCOS VM should boot on Nutanix without an Ignition config
Actual Behavior
VM doesn't boot up properly without an Ignition
Reproduction Steps
Use this guide for launching a VM in Nutanix AHV but don't provide an Ignition config.
